Deputy Defense Minister Alon Shuster told Reshet Bet this morning that the government had to take into account "various sensitivities" in its policy toward expansion of settlements.

Shuster was responding to a report in Kan News that the government had decided to block the construction of 1000 housing units in areas over the Green Line.

"When we established the current government, we said that we would strengthen the settlement enterprise, while continuing to take into account various sensitivities on the issue," Shuster said.
